The commission or commission representative must approve all equipment used in conjunction with the contest.
- A. The gong: The gong must not be less than ten (10) inches in diameter, and it must be adjusted and secured at ringside.
- B. Scales: The commission must approve, in advance of any contest, any scale that will be used for any contestant weigh-in.
- C. Buckets and bottles: There must be a clean bucket and a clean bottle in each contestant’s corner for each bout or event, along with an additional bucket for the disposal of contaminated materials in each corner.
- D. Second’s stools: The promoter must provide second’s stools for each contestant’s corner.
- E. Miscellaneous equipment: The promoter must provide gloves, water, mats and any other equipment or articles as required by the commission for the proper conduct of any bout or event.
